PIC32CX-BZ and WBZ Family Features


Bluetooth® Microcontroller Modules and SoCs

Designed from the ground up to enable you to go to market quickly, this family is powered by an Arm Cortex-M4F processor and is packed with features.
  • General-purpose Arm Cortex-M4F MCU with integrated wireless including:
    • Bluetooth® Low Energy (LE) 5.2
    • Zigbee® 3.0
    • Thread® 1.3.0
    • Proprietary and other IEEE® 802.15.4 protocols including MiWi™ protocol
  • Up to 1 MB Flash and 128 KB RAM
  • A rich set of peripherals including ADC, DAC and touch inputs
  • Advanced on-board security engine with TRNG, SHA and ECC
  • Automotive AEC-Q100 Grade 1-qualified (125°C) 
  • Functional safety-ready classification (automotive ISO 26262 ASIL B and industrial IEC 61508 SIL 2 compliance)
  • Globally pre-certified modules that shorten time to market by eliminating RF design and reducing regulatory requirements

Why Design With Our Bluetooth Microcontrollers?


Robust Wireless Icon

Robust Performance

Our PIC32CX-BZ and WBZ family is built to thrive in tough environments. These devices are temperature tolerant and provide stable RF performance regardless of the conditions.

Advanced Periperhals Icon

Advanced Peripherals

With up to 29 GPIOs, it is easy to add features that set your application apart. This MCU family supports a rich set of peripherals including capacitive touch, ADC and DAC.

Wireless Module Icon

Product Selection

In addition to SoCs, we design and build our own RF-ready modules. If you want more customization, we provide chip-down reference design packages for building your own module.

MPLAB-X-IDE

MPLAB® X Integrated Development Environment (IDE) is an expandable, highly configurable software program that incorporates powerful tools to help you discover, configure, develop, debug and qualify embedded designs for most of Microchip’s microcontrollers, microprocessors and digital signal controllers.

MPLAB Harmony v3

MPLAB® Harmony is a modular framework that provides interoperable firmware libraries for application development on 32-bit microcontrollers and microprocessors.

code-configurator

MPLAB Code Configurator supports 8-bit, 16-bit and 32-bit PIC® microcontrollers. MCC is incorporated into both the downloadable MPLAB X Integrated Development Environment (IDE) and the cloud-based MPLAB Xpress IDE.
